My boot time went from ~25s to about 40 sec. That's bad. bootchart says landscape-* programs are eating a lot of disk IO.
Whatever it's doing probably isn't urgent. It would be really nice if it didn't affect my system in any way I can notice.
In the init file, please use some combination of
--nicelevel int
--iosched class:priority
to make landscape clients less intrusive.
There's also
--chuid username|uid
so you can get rid of that "sudo" too.
